Lacchiarella, a region in Italy's Lombardy, is characterized by its predominantly flat, agricultural landscapes, typical of the Po Valley. This terrain makes it suitable for a variety of outdoor activities, particularly those that benefit from accessible, level ground. Key natural features include the Ticino River and the historical Naviglio Pavese canal, both of which offer natural environments for exploration. The area supports several sports like road cycling, touring cycling, hiking, mountain biking, and more.

Lacchiarella features numerous road cycling routes, often utilizing the flat terrain of the Po Valley. Routes like the "Strada per Badile – Anello della Chiusa di Moirago" (24.9 miles [40.1 km]) pass historical sites. Yes, Lacchiarella offers touring cycling routes along historical waterways. The "Naviglio Pavese Cycle Path" (62.8 miles [101 km]) connects rural towns along the ancient canal system. This path provides scenic views of ancient mills and farmhouses.
Mountain biking trails in Lacchiarella include the "Houseboat on the Ticino River – Trail Along the Ticino loop" (31.3 miles [50.4 km]) and the "Vernavola Park – Vernavola Trail loop" (24.5 miles [39.4 km]). Yes, Lacchiarella's flat terrain makes it suitable for easy and family-friendly cycling. Routes such as the "Villamaggiore (Lacchiarella) – Oasi Lacchiarella loop" (10.1 miles [16.3 km]) are ideal for families. The extensive network of cycle paths along waterways also offers accessible options.
Lacchiarella provides opportunities for nature walks along its waterways, such as the Ticino River and Naviglio Pavese. The landscape around Lacchiarella is characterized by expansive, flat agricultural fields. Key natural features include the Ticino River, which offers natural environments, and the historical Naviglio Pavese canal, known for its dedicated cycle paths and picturesque views.

Yes, Lacchiarella offers long-distance cycling options, including parts of the "Strada delle Abbazie." These routes allow cyclists to explore historical churches and monasteries in the greater Milan area, connecting various points of interest.
The terrain in Lacchiarella is predominantly flat, characterized by agricultural landscapes of the Po Valley. This makes it highly accessible for various cycling disciplines, including road, touring, and mountain biking, with minimal elevation changes.
